SUMMARY:Mentoring Masterclass (Option 2)
DESCRIPTION:We are excited to offer masterclasses to build on existing skills and knowledge as a mentor. These sessions are structured as two sessions with linking themes; please ensure that you can attend both Part A and Part B of this option. \nOption 2 \nBoth sessions (a & b) must be attended of option 2: \nPart A: 13/01/2025  1:00pm – 4:00pm \nPart B: 18/3/2025 1:00pm – 4:00pm \nPart A will focus on: The mind-set of being a mentor by\n• introducing you to the skills and attitudes of being a mentor\n• building confidence in fulfilling the role of mentor\n• providing framework(s) that will support being an effective mentor\no Beginnings\,\no Middles\, and\no Endings\n• Including the quality assurance of mentoring by building quality relationships\, and ensuring each mentee has a consistent experience \nPart B will focus on: The application of mentoring tools\n• Deploying the mentoring mind-set introduced in Session A\n• Experimenting with tools and techniques to ensure the accountability of the mentee sits appropriately\n• Techniques which help deepen the mentoring relationship\n• Sharing of ‘live encounters’ (protecting confidentiality)\, tips and tricks\n• Tools to support the conversations outlined above. \nThese sessions are open to all mentors across the NEY region\, including those supporting in-house mentoring offers. It is not necessary to have completed an accredited pathway such as ILM5 Coaching and Mentoring but attendees should have accessed some mentoring development and have acted as a mentor to benefit from these sessions. SUMMARY:Systems Thinking Essentials
DESCRIPTION:Our actions have far-reaching effects\, and as system leaders\, our thinking\, approaches\, and problem-solving strategies are always evolving. Systems thinking emphasises the importance of understanding processes\, interactions\, and the interconnectedness of various elements—it’s inherently complex and dynamic. ​ \nIn this module\, we’ll concentrate on the relationships\, complexities\, and dynamics within the systems you operate in\, examining both the benefits and challenges. You’ll gain insights on how to leverage systems thinking to drive impactful change.
